#538be3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#538be3 is composed of 32.5% red, 54.5% green and 89%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.4% cyan, 38.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 216.7 degrees, a saturation of 72% and a lightness of 60.8%. #538be3 color hex could be obtained by blending #a6ffff with #0017c7.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

#538be3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#538be3 has RGB values of R:83, G:139, B:227 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0.39,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 5475299.

Shades and Tints of #538be3
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02070e is the darkest color, while #fcfd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#538be3
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#989a9e is the less saturated color, while #3c86fa is the most saturated one.
